The Roman Catholic Diocese of Marília (Template:Langx) is a diocese located in the city of Marília in the ecclesiastical province of Botucatu in Brazil.
History
- February 16, 1952: Established as Diocese of Marília from the Diocese of Lins
Bishops
- Bishops of Marília (Roman rite), in reverse chronological order:
- Bishop Luiz Antônio Cipolini (2013.05.08 - present)
- Bishop Osvaldo Giuntini (1992.12.09 – 2013.05.08)
- Bishop Daniel Tomasella, OFMCap (1975.04.23 – 1992.12.09)
- Archbishop (personal title) Hugo Bressane de Araújo (1954.10.07 – 1975.04.23)
Coadjutor bishops
- Daniel Arnaldo Tomasella, OFMCap (1975)
- Osvaldo Giuntini (1987-1992)
Auxiliary bishops
- Daniel Arnaldo Tomasella, OFMCap (1969-1975), appointed Coadjutor here
- Osvaldo Giuntini (1982-1987), appointed Coadjutor here
Other priest of this diocese who became bishop
- Paulo Roberto Beloto, appointed Bishop of Formosa, Goias in 2005
